BATHURST, N.B. -- Jonathan Drouin scored and added three assists as the Halifax Mooseheads dominated the Acadie-Bathurst Titan in a 9-1 victory on Sunday in Quebec Major Junior Hockey League action. Darcy Ashley and Luca Ciampini had a goal and two assists each for Halifax (30-16-1), which won its fourth consecutive game. Brent Andrews, Brandon Vuic, Danny Moynihan, Nikolaj Ehlers, Matt Murphy and Philippe Gadoury also scored for the Mooseheads. Goaltender Zachary Fucale made 22 saves for the win. Simon Fortier was the lone scorer for Acadie-Bathurst (17-25-4).
